Market Ecosystem & Operational Framework Key Product Categories Liquid Acetic Peracid: The dominant form, used in disinfectants, water treatment, and surface sterilization. Solid & Powdered Forms: Emerging niche for storage stability and ease of transportation, primarily in industrial applications. Pre-mixed Formulations: Ready-to-use solutions tailored for specific end-user needs, gaining traction in healthcare and food sectors. Stakeholders & Demand-Supply Framework Raw Material Suppliers: Acetic acid producers, peroxygen compounds, stabilizers, and catalysts. Manufacturers: Chemical companies specializing in synthesis, stabilization, and formulation of acetic peracid products. Distributors & Logistics: Regional distributors, warehousing, and logistics providers ensuring timely supply chain management. End-Users: Healthcare facilities, municipal water authorities, food processing units, industrial cleaning firms, and research institutions. Value Chain & Revenue Models The value chain begins with raw material procurement, primarily acetic acid and peroxygen compounds, sourced globally from regions like China, Japan, and the US. Manufacturing involves catalytic oxidation and stabilization processes, with R&D investments focused on improving yield, stability, and environmental profile. Distribution channels include direct sales to large industrial clients and third-party distributors serving smaller end-users. Revenue models are predominantly based on product sales, with premium pricing for specialized formulations and value-added services such as technical support, system integration, and lifecycle management. Lifecycle services include product maintenance, technical upgrades, and compliance consulting, which generate recurring revenue streams. Adoption Trends & End-User Insights Healthcare: Increased adoption of acetic peracid for sterilization in hospitals, clinics, and laboratories, driven by infection control protocols. Water Treatment: Municipal and industrial water facilities favor acetic peracid due to its efficacy and environmentally benign profile. Food Industry: Food processing plants utilize acetic peracid for surface sanitation, with a shift toward formulations that meet organic and safety standards. Industrial Cleaning: Manufacturing units employ acetic peracid for equipment sterilization, especially in electronics and pharmaceutical sectors. Shifting consumption patterns favor ready-to-use formulations and digital system integration, enabling real-time monitoring and compliance documentation.
